About Stillwater (colorado)

Stillwater Campground is located on Lake Granby, six miles southeast of Grand Lake, in north central Colorado. Visitors enjoy the area for its great boating, fishing and hiking opportunities. The necessary Arapaho National Recreation Area pass can now be purchased online (Interagency Age and Access passes are also valid)!  

Number of accommodations: 79

Lindsay M

Verified

January 14, 2020 Stayed at: C107, Loop: Loop C

4

We camped 2 nights in early Sep. 2019. Just a heads up the campsites are close together compared to other campgrounds. During our stay, there were afternoon thunderstorms that would come in pretty fast with really gusty wind and then move out just as fast. Even on a clear day be prepared for wind and it being pretty chilly at night that time of year. Due to the beetle kill there are not a lot of trees, only a handful, so I would bring a canopy or someway to make some shade. The campsite is kept very clean and the bathrooms were very clean as well. We had a spit right next too the bathroom, convenient but a lot of foot traffic by our tent. I would advise not picking a campsite near the bathroom as the bathrooms and shower houses are all within a short walking distance to any campsite. Also, I will say that if you have a large tent, like ours that sleeps 6-8, your tent may not fit on the tent pad, and they have pretty strict rules against setting up in the grass. If you have multiple parties trying to share a campground you will not fit with more than one large tent or more than two of those little igloo-looking pop-up tents. I would highly suggest reserving campgrounds next to each other. We enjoyed the water, next time we will bring more water toys. Most campsites have a beautiful view of the lake. There were lots of mountain flowers as well. Beautiful cozy little campground.

Policies & Rules

Category About
General

RV water connections are only available on sites with electric hookups. RV connections are not available at the non-electric sites.

General

This is bear country! For bear and human safety, keep a clean campsite and do not place food or other attractants in your tent. For more information about visiting bear country, contact Colorado Parks and Wildlife at http://wildlife.state.co.us

General

Boats are subject to inspection to prevent the spread of zebra and quagga mussels.

General

Click here to purchase the Arapaho National Recreation Area pass; Interagency America the Beautiful Age and Access passports are valid for admission

General

You must stay in the campsite you reserved. Site-swapping is not allowed.

General

Amperage is variable with choices of 20, 30, and 50 amps.

General

https://www.fs.usda.gov/r02/arp for more information on the Arapaho and Roosevelt National Forests

General

Don't Move Firewood: Prevent the spread of tree-killing organisms by obtaining firewood at or near your destination and burning it on-site. For more information visit dontmovefirewood.org.

General

All campsites must be occupied within 26 hours of the beginning of the reservation. If not present the site will be rented by first come first serve basis.

General

EXTRA VEHICLE FEES: One vehicle is included in your reservation. Any additional vehicles will be charged $8.00 per vehicle per night and will be collected by the camphost. There is not a way to pay for extra vehicles when you make your reservation. One vehicle consists of one camper being towed by vehicle, or any other vehicle towed behind camper. One van or one truck with camper attached counts as one vehicle. 

General

Fire Restrictions: Fire restrictions may be imposed at any time due to hot, dry weather conditions, at which time campfires and charcoal fires may not be allowed. 

General

Tents must fit on pads provided. RVs, trailers or other vehicles must fit on the parking spur. Driving or parking off road is not permitted. Parking can accomodate RVs of many sizes; spurs range from 25 to 40 feet in length.

General

Modifications for this campground must be made through Recreation.gov PRIOR to your reservation start date. Customers and contact center agents cannot modify reservations on or after the check-in date.
